摘要
在矿压较大的孤岛煤柱中,根据水采矿压显现的实际规律,在应力降低区内布置回采巷道。由于巷道布置的改革,从而避开了矿压峰值的破坏作用,减少了巷道开掘和维护难度,顺利采出了原煤。由此实践经验总结出类似条件下水采回采巷道的布置方法。
Based on the actual pattern of rock pressuremanifestation in hydromines, the extraction headingsare arranged in zones presenting reduced stress inworking the Gudao pillar under great rock pressure,for avoiding the destructive effect if peak rock pressure and facilitating the drivage and maintenance ofheadings. On the basis of the successful mining operation in this mine,a general method for arranging theheadings under similar conditions has been proposed.
